Artichoke hearts bring a subtle, nutty sweetness that transforms traditional hummus into something unexpectedly luxurious. When blended with earthy chickpeas and bright lemon juice, they create a dip that feels both familiar and entirely new.
The key to that silky texture lies in the order of operations. By processing the artichokes and tahini first with the aromatics, you break down the fibrous vegetable completely before thinning with ice-cold water. This method ensures every spoonful is light and airy rather than dense or pasty.
Serving Suggestions
This hummus carries a gentle acidity that pairs beautifully with robust flavours. Try it alongside:
- Warm pita bread drizzled with za'atar oil
- Crisp cucumber rounds and radish slices
- Grilled lamb kebabs or falafel wraps
Store any leftovers in an airtight container for up to four days, though the vibrant lemon notes are best enjoyed fresh. A final flourish of olive oil and whole chickpeas on top adds that essential restaurant-style finish.
